The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Davies, born in 1846 in Hope, Flintshire, consisted of 7 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Jane Davies, born in 1848 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ales. They had 4 children; Matthew (born 1868 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ales), Sarah (born 1875 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ales), Catherine (born 1877 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ales) and Margaret A (born 1879 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ales).
During the period, also present in the household was Edward's Lodger, George Dutton, born in 1862 in Hope, Flintshire, Wales.
